Who we are:
MACCS Medical Group is Victoria’s largest private paediatric allergy centre. We bring together a large group of paediatric specialists to deliver the highest level of care for our patients and their families. Our medical team includes allergists and immunologists, general paediatricians, sleep physician, ENT surgeon, dietitian and a speech pathologist. We also have a large allergy challenge centre and have an excellent nursing team supporting the practice.
MACCS Medical Group is conveniently co-located with the Royal Children’ Hospital, providing excellent access to public transport. Our specialists have very strong links with the Royal Children’s Hospital and many are actively involved with medical research.

Duties and Responsibilities
- Administer food/drug challenges to patients with suspected allergies
- .Perform Skin Prick Tests for patients with suspected allergies
- Provide Immunotherapy injections, immunotherapy and other medications to patients.
- Provide education to patients and their families
